As all eyes turn to Willie le Roux’s milestone 100th Test match for the Springboks this Saturday in Gqeberha, another stalwart continues to quietly defy the odds and deliver: Makazole Mapimpi. At 34 years old, Mapimpi remains one of the most prolific wings South African rugby has ever seen. He is set to earn his 47th Test cap against Italy. With 32 international tries already to his name, he boasts a strike rate few can match. Springbok captain Siya Kolisi has been given an extra week to recover from minor injuries. He is now expected to make his return in South Africa’s upcoming Test against Georgia in Nelspruit. Kolisi has been managing a stiff neck and lingering Achilles discomfort. This saw him miss the Springboks’ non-cap international against the Barbarians on 28 June. He also missed the opening Test match against Italy at Loftus Versfeld, a game South Africa won convincingly 42–24. The countdown has begun as Betway SA20 confirms its return with a thrilling lineup for Season 4. This sets the stage for a summer packed with top-tier T20 action across the country. Cricket fans can now mark their calendars with the competition kicking off earlier than usual—on Boxing Day, 26 December 2025. Blockbuster Boxing Day Opener Defending champions MI Cape Town will launch the tournament against Durban’s Super Giants at Newlands, Cape Town. This matchup promises an electric start to the season. Orlando Pirates have officially announced that winger Monnapule Saleng will be spending the 2025/26 campaign on loan at newly-promoted Orbit College. The unexpected move was confirmed by the club on Wednesday. This marks a significant development in the player’s future following a turbulent season at Mayfair. Saleng’s exit had been anticipated after months of speculation. This was particularly after his absence from the matchday squad during the latter half of the previous Premier Soccer League season. The policy of issuing driving licence cards with limited validity periods in South Africa has come under renewed scrutiny. Experts argue that it offers no proven benefit to road safety. In fact, some suggest it may have even worsened the situation. According to Rob Handfield-Jones, managing director of Driving.co.za and a respected authority on road safety, there is no credible research linking short licence card validity periods with improved safety on South Africa’s roads. “There’s no evidence that the introduction of licence cards had any positive effect on road safety,” he said.
